#0a193c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a193c is composed of 3.9% red, 9.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 13.7%. #0a193c color hex could be obtained by blending #143278 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#0a193c color description : Very dark blue.

#0a193c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0a193c has RGB values of R:10, G:25,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 661820.

Shades and Tints of #0a193c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040a is the darkest color, while #f8fafe is the lightest one.
